Abstract
Objective: To optimize the technical conditions of ethanol percolation extraction for Citri Grandis Exocarpium Plaster. Method: The content of naringin extracted from Citri Grandis Exocarpium
which was regarded as the marker of detection
was determined by high performance liquid chromatography and was used to optimize the extraction processing conditions by L9(34) orthogonal test. Result: The optimum extraction condition was that the concentration of ethanol was 80%
the volume of solvent was 15 times of medicinal materials
the soaking time was 24 hours and the percolating speed was 5 mL ·min-1 ·kg-1. The average transferring rate of naringin in 3 batches of samples was 79.0%. Conclusion: The optimum extraction process is reasonable and the transferring rate of naringin is higher.
